In partnership with the New York State Athletic Trainers’ Association, the Brain Injury Association of New York State is offering COPE: Concussion Outreach Prevention & Education programming. Presented in locations across the state, COPE sessions are open to anyone engaged with student athletes – parents, athletic trainers, school administrators, coaches, youth sports organizations. Is it old-school coaching or bullying? Coaches adapt to a changing game
Instead of reaming kids out after a mistake during a game, coaches say they now talk to players privately the next day in practice.
